Turtleneck Tees for Layering
I do like the design of these turtleneck tees by Mango Outlet. They would be great to layer under cardigans, blazers and jacket.
A blazer is always a put together 3rd piece. I know, you are thinking: Where am I going? It’s just one of those piece you can wear out to a restaurant or if you are on a Zoom call. Not to mention, you will have it for future events. This faux leather blazer from Nordstrom is a sharp way to layer and look polished. I love a double breasted look.
A Plaid blazer or menswear look has been popular for a number of years This one, a double breasted blazer from H&M looks effortlessly cool! I bought several plaid jackets from them last year and am pleased with the quality.
Long duster cardigans are a great 3rd piece to add to your look. My mom is a casual dresser, and I mentioned how her tee shirts or graphic tees would look great with a pair of dark denim and a long cardigan such as this one from Nordstrom. You can wear them with anything from pants to dresses and denim.
A Pair of cute sneakers that are stylish and comfortable will amplify your look . I bought my hubby several pairs of Cole Haan Sneakers and these women’s sneakers have such cute details like the scalloping and leopard print.
For Fall, one staple is always a great bag. This bag, from Mango Outlet is a gorgeous shade of chocolate brown.
A staple you need for your closet is a great pair of denim. I love dark denim for Fall and ones with some stretch for comfort and movement.
These are ones I own by Wit and Wisdom. The jeans with Ab-solution waist bands are true to size. I like to have variety of styles of jeans in my wardrobe These are a bootcut.
